Northwood Company manufactures basketballs. The company has a standard ball that sells for $25. At present, the standard ball is manufactured in a small plant that relies heavily on direct labor workers. Thus, variable costs are high, totaling $15 per ball.
Last year, the company sold 30,000 standard balls, with the following results:
Sales (30,000 standard balls) $750,000
Less variable expenses 450,000
Contribution margin 300,000
Less fixed expenses 210,000
Net income $ 90,000
Required 1. Compute (a) the CM ratio and the break-even point in balls, and (b) the degree of operating leverage at last years level of sales.
2. Due to an increase in labor rates, the company estimates that variable costs will increase by $3 per ball next year. If this change takes place and the selling price per ball remains constant at $25, what will be the new CM ratio and break-even point in balls?
3. Refer to the data in (2) above. If the expected change in variable costs takes place, how many balls will have to be sold next year to earn the same net income ($90,000) as last year?
4. Refer to the original data. The company is discussing the construction of a new, automated plant to manufacture the standard balls. The new plant would slash variable costs per ball by 40%, but it would cause fixed costs to double in amount per year. If the new plant is built, what would be the companys new CM ratio and new break-even point in balls?
5. Refer to the data in (4) above.
a. If the new plant is built, how many balls will have to be sold next year to earn the same net income ($90,000) as last year?
b. Assume the new plant is built and that next year the company manufactures and sells 30,000 balls (the same number as sold last year). Prepare a contribution income statement and compute the degree of operating leverage.
c. If you were a member of top management, would you
have voted in favor of constructing the new plant? Explain.
